💥 Garment Styles & Constructions
A crash course for knitters who want to actually understand what they’re casting on.
This mini-course is your go-to guide for demystifying the most common sweater constructions and styles — no jargon, no guesswork, just clear explanations and visual breakdowns.
By the end of this workshop, you’ll be able to spot different garment types, understand how they’re built, and know exactly what you’re getting into before you cast on.
What You’ll Learn Inside (aka: what you’re really signing up for):
🧶 THE CONSTRUCTIONS
Understand how sweaters are built, from seamed and seamless to top-down and bottom-up, and how each one affects your knitting experience.
👕 THE STYLES
Learn the defining features of drop shoulders, circular yokes, and raglans, and how to tell them apart at a glance.
✅ THE PROS & CONS
Every construction has tradeoffs. You’ll get a clear, no-fluff breakdown of the strengths and quirks of each one.
👀 THE VISUAL CUES
You’ll learn how to identify each construction and style just by looking — no pattern-reading required.
🧠 THE CONFIDENCE TO CHOOSE
No more feeling unsure or overwhelmed when browsing Ravelry. You’ll know what you’re looking at, what it means, and how it’s made.
Why This Course Matters
Most knitters follow the pattern without ever really understanding what they’re building — and that’s fine… until it’s not.
This workshop gives you the tools to look at a sweater, understand its construction, and choose patterns with clarity.
It’s knowledge that makes you feel smarter, faster, and way more in control of your knitting.
